| THIS MONTH IN NAVAL HISTORY
July 3rd 1898- The entire Spanish fleet in Cuba is defeated when it engages the US blockading force. The Spanish lose the Teresa, Vizcaya, Colon, Oquendo, Pluton and the Furor. The Americans lost one sailor.
July 4, 1942 The USS Triton SS-201 sinks the Japanese destroyer Nenhi off the coast of the Aleutians.
July 1st 1776- The Connecticut naval vessel Defence captures the HMS John
July 13th 1776- The USS Reprisal encounters and captures the HMS Peter
July 6th 1777- The USS Hancock is captured by the HMS Rainbow off of Halifax
July 2-30th-1812 The USS President operating in the North Atlantic, cpatures the the HMS Traverler, Duchess of Portland and the John Lancaster.
July 18th –29th 1813- The USS President defeats the HMS Daphne, Eliza Swan and Alert off the English coast.
July 6th 1814- The USS Wasp engaged and defeats the HMS Wasp
